2023-2030 年全球超大规模云端市场规模研究与预测(按企业类型、按应用、产业和区域分析)Global Hyperscale Cloud Market Size Study & Forecast, by Enterprise Type, By Application, By Industry, and Regional Analysis, 2023-2030 |
2022年全球超大规模云端市场价值约为1,722.6亿美元,预计在2023-2030年预测期内将以超过37.8%的健康成长率成长。超大规模云端是指特定类型的云端运算架构,旨在提供巨大的可扩展性、高效能和灵活性,以处理极高的工作负载和资料量。此术语与重要的公有云服务供应商相关,例如 Amazon Web Services (AWS)、Microsoft Azure、Google Cloud Platform (GCP) 等。行动和物联网设备的日益普及、各种企业对云端运算的使用不断增加、高速互联网的可用性不断提高以及对灾难復原和业务连续性的日益关注是支撑全球市场需求的关键因素。
此外,5G 的日益普及和边缘运算的不断升级为预计期间的市场扩张提供了各种成长前景。与前几代网路相比,5G 网路提供更快的资料速度和更低的延迟。这使得能够透过与超大规模云端资源结合来开发更先进的行动应用程式和物联网 (IoT) 解决方案。目前,网路营运商迫切希望透过软体定义基础设施充分利用其 5G 投资。根据产业贸易组织5G Americas 报告称,已记录了约19 亿个5G 连接,预计到2027 年该数字还会上升,很可能达到59 亿个5G 连接。随着超大规模生态系统因记忆体相关问题而面临越来越多的困难、储存、频宽、运算能力和速度,5G 技术正在将更多智慧推向边缘,并为营运商提供了先前的选择。 5G 网路提供更低的延迟和更高的资料传输,促进更流畅的即时应用,包括线上游戏、视讯游戏和扩增实境/虚拟实境。因此,上述因素正在推动超大规模云端市场的成长。此外,人工智慧(AI)和机器学习(ML)的兴起,以及主要市场参与者对技术进步的投资不断增加,在预测几年内带来了各种利润丰厚的机会。然而,对安全漏洞的日益担忧,以及建置和维护超大规模云端设施的高昂成本,正在阻碍 2023-2030 年预测期内的市场成长。
全球超大规模云端市场研究考虑的关键区域包括亚太地区、北美、欧洲、拉丁美洲以及中东和非洲。由于人工智慧和机器学习在各行各业的各种业务中日益普及,以及对处理大量数位资料的日益关注,北美在 2022 年占据了市场主导地位。此外,AWS、微软、Google等重要超大规模企业的出现进一步推动了区域市场的成长。 AAG(一家 IT 技术公司)在 2023 年 7 月估计,Google、微软和亚马逊可能会主导云端产业 66% 的份额。此外,报告也指出,在美国,医疗保健领域的云端运算预计在 2020 年至 2025 年间将成长 40%,而亚太地区预计将成为预测年份成长最快的地区。 SaaS 解决方案的日益普及、城市化进程的不断发展以及数位技术利用率的不断提高是推动该地区市场需求的主要因素。主要区域公司也致力于增强和发展其云端基础设施,以建立强大的网路。例如,2022年8月,Google打算在泰国、马来西亚和纽西兰增设三个云端区域,以满足不断增长的云端服务需求。

Global Hyperscale Cloud Market is valued at approximately USD 172.26 billion in 2022 and is anticipated to grow with a healthy growth rate of more than 37.8% over the forecast period 2023-2030. Hyperscale cloud refers to a specific type of cloud computing architecture that is built to offer immense scalability, high performance, and flexibility to handle extremely high workloads and data volumes. The term is associated with significant public cloud service providers, such as Amazon Web Services (AWS), Microsoft Azure, Google Cloud Platform (GCP), and others. The increasing penetration of mobile and IoT devices, rising usage of cloud computing by various businesses, increasing availability of high-speed internet, and growing focus on disaster recovery and business continuity are the key factors bolstering the market demand across the globe.
Additionally, the growing adoption of 5G and escalating edge computing is providing various growth prospects for market expansion during the estimated period. 5G networks offer significantly faster data speeds and lower latency compared to previous generations. This enables the development of more advanced mobile applications and Internet of Things (IoT) solutions by combining with hyperscale cloud resources. Network operators currently are eager to capitalize on their 5G investment with software-defined infrastructure. According to the 5G Americas- an industry trade organization reported that approximately 1.9 billion of 5G connections were recorded, which is projected to rise and is likely to reach 5.9 billion 5G connections by 2027. With the hyperscale ecosystem facing increasing difficulties with issues related to memory, storage, bandwidth, computing power, and speed, 5G technologies are pushing more intelligence to the edge and presenting operators with previous options. 5G networks provide lower latency and higher data transfers, facilitating smoother real-time applications including online gaming, video gaming, and augmented reality/virtual reality. Thus, these aforementioned factors are propelling the growth of the Hyperscale Cloud Market. Moreover, the rise of artificial intelligence (AI) and machine learning (ML), as well as growing investment in technological advancements by the key market players present various lucrative opportunities over the forecast years. However, the increasing concerns regarding security breaches, along with the high cost of building and maintaining hyperscale cloud facilities are hampering the market growth throughout the forecast period of 2023-2030.
The key regions considered for the Global Hyperscale Cloud Market study include Asia Pacific, North America, Europe, Latin America, and Middle East & Africa. North America dominated the market in 2022 owing to the rising popularity of AI and ML among various businesses in a variety of industries, as well as the rising focus on processing large volumes of digital data. Additionally, the presence of significant hyperscalers such as AWS, Microsoft, Google, and others is further attributing to the regional market growth. The AAG (an IT technology company) estimated in July 2023 that Google, Microsoft, and Amazon are likely to dominate 66% of the cloud industry. Also, the report noted that in the United States, cloud computing in healthcare is predicted to increase by 40% between 2020 and 2025, Whereas, Asia Pacific is expected as the fastest growing region over the forecast years. The rising adoption of SaaS solutions, growing urbanization, coupled with the increasing utilization of digital technologies are the leading factors that are contributing towards the market demand across the region. Major regional companies are also concentrating on enhancing and growing their cloud infrastructure in order to build strong networks. For instance, in August 2022, Google intended to establish three additional cloud regions in Thailand, Malaysia, and Zealand to satisfy the rising demand for cloud services.
